Subject: [PATCH v3 1/4] mfd: intel-m10-bmc: Fix the register access range
Date: Mon, 1 Mar 2021 13:59:42 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1614578385-26955-2-git-send-email-yilun.xu@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1614578385-26955-1-git-send-email-yilun.xu@intel.com>
This patch fixes the max register address of MAX 10 BMC. The range
0x20000000 ~ 0x200000fc are for control registers of the QSPI flash
controller, which are not accessible to host.
